Diplomacy: President Obama sat for a White House photo op with the Palestinian Authority's leader and then announced a $400 million aid package for the West Bank and Gaza. What's wrong with this picture?

The president seemed to go out of his way this week to please his latest guest, President Mahmoud Abbas of the Palestinian Authority, in a way he didn't when Israel's prime minister, Benjamin Netanyahu, came calling last month.

Declaring "the situation in Gaza (as) unsustainable," he called on Israel to lighten its blockade on the terrorist-led regime in Gaza. And as a sweetener for the Palestinians, he appeared for an Oval Office photo with Abbas. Such a photo op was denied to Netanyahu.

Then the president whipped out the government checkbook to present a $400 million gift to Abbas' government, $70 million more than the original commitment, supposedly for public works projects in the West Bank and Hamas-ruled Gaza.

According to the White House Web site, the U.S. will build five new schools in Gaza for $10 million, plus provide $240 million in West Bank mortgage aid, fresh water pipelines and health care.

Why the U.S. should be supporting a regime that so far this year has fired 370 lethal rockets into Israel, that still refuses to recognize Israel's right to exist and that has made a cottage industry of teaching children to hate is beyond us.

Extra cash for the same people who danced in the streets on 9/11 will just free up more resources for new terror and mayhem against the Jewish state. Some $10 billion has been spent globally in the last decade on Palestine, and places like Gaza remain as miserably pro-terrorist as ever.

And don't think for one minute that Hamas will be grateful. Obama's remarks "were problematic and empty of meaning because they are part of a U.S. policy to prettify the siege of Gaza," a Hamas spokesman told AFP.

How all this aid will get to Gaza remains to be seen. Abbas' Palestinian Authority rules the West Bank and is a rival to the Hamas terrorists running Gaza, where it supposedly has no authority.

If the plan is to buy off Gazans so they'll vote for non-terrorists, it's hard to see how this would work. Hamas could refuse to let the U.S. build the schools, just as the group refused aid from Israel-inspected ships that ran the Gaza blockade. These aren't people who help themselves.
